Invincible Armada 2003
Easily dominating the 2002 WRC MotoGP class with the revolutionary RC211V, Honda deployed 7 RC211V to 4 teams for the 2003 season. One of the teams, Team Honda Pons, underwent big changes in 2003 with new sponsorship from tobacco giant Camel and two new riders, Max Biaggi and Tohru Ukawa. Like other teams, Team Honda Pons RC211V featured revolutionary technology including the powerful V5 4-stroke engine and Honda's unique unit pro-link suspension. With Biaggi finishing 3rd overall in the Riders Championship and Ukawa performing consistently all throughout the season, the yellow RC211V showed its strength and reliability on circuits around the world.

About the Model:
A beautifully finished 1/12 scale fully assembled model of the RC211V which took Max Biaggi to 3rd place in the 2003 Riders Championship.
Accurately reproduced revolutionaly V5 engine and unique unit pro-link suspension.
Specially altered tank cover and seat cowling redesigned to match the small physique of the Honda Pons riders has also been accurately reproduced.
Wheels made using die-cast parts, creating a realistic sense of weight and power.
Overall length: 168mm
